.viewer.svelte-b03d7p.svelte-b03d7p{--containerSize:100vw}@media(min-width: 1400px){.viewer.svelte-b03d7p.svelte-b03d7p{--containerSize:1320px}}.viewer-grid.svelte-b03d7p.svelte-b03d7p{display:grid;grid-template-columns:50% 50%;--leaderFrac:0.5}.viewer-grid-leader.svelte-b03d7p.svelte-b03d7p{display:grid;grid-template-columns:1fr 1fr 1fr 1fr 1fr;--leaderFrac:0.2}.viewer-grid-leader.svelte-b03d7p div.svelte-b03d7p{padding:2px}.leader.svelte-b03d7p.svelte-b03d7p{grid-column:1 / span 4;grid-row:1 / span 3;--leaderFrac:0.8}.colspan.svelte-b03d7p.svelte-b03d7p{grid-column:1 / span 2;--leaderFrac:1}.row.svelte-b03d7p.svelte-b03d7p{--bs-gutter-x:0}.hidden.svelte-b03d7p.svelte-b03d7p{display:none}section.svelte-1h42put div.svelte-1h42put{margin:1em 0 .6em}@media(min-width: 66rem){.input-fields-container.svelte-1h42put.svelte-1h42put{display:flex;flex-wrap:wrap;margin:-1rem}}.trans.svelte-13bdctw.svelte-13bdctw{transition:all .5s linear}video.svelte-13bdctw.svelte-13bdctw{max-width:100%;height:100%;vertical-align:bottom}.videoContainer.svelte-13bdctw.svelte-13bdctw{position:relative;aspect-ratio:16/9;text-align:center;overflow:hidden}.vblock.svelte-13bdctw.svelte-13bdctw{display:inline-block;position:absolute;width:101%;height:101%;background-color:#2c3e50;top:50%;left:50%;transform:translate(-50%, -50%)}.vdisabled.svelte-13bdctw.svelte-13bdctw{display:inline-block;position:absolute;padding:4em;background-color:#0007;top:50%;left:50%;transform:translate(-50%, -50%)}.lds-ring.svelte-13bdctw.svelte-13bdctw{display:inline-block;position:absolute;width:80px;height:80px;top:50%;left:50%;transform:translate(-50%, -50%)}.lds-ring.svelte-13bdctw div.svelte-13bdctw{box-sizing:border-box;display:block;position:absolute;width:64px;height:64px;margin:8px;border:8px solid #fff;border-radius:50%;animation:svelte-13bdctw-lds-ring 2.4s cubic-bezier(0.5, 0, 0.5, 1) infinite;border-color:#2c3e50 transparent transparent transparent}.lds-ring.svelte-13bdctw div.svelte-13bdctw:nth-child(1){animation-delay:-0.9s}.lds-ring.svelte-13bdctw div.svelte-13bdctw:nth-child(2){animation-delay:-0.6s}.lds-ring.svelte-13bdctw div.svelte-13bdctw:nth-child(3){animation-delay:-0.3s}@keyframes svelte-13bdctw-lds-ring{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.userOverlay.svelte-13bdctw.svelte-13bdctw{position:absolute;z-index:1;width:100%;aspect-ratio:16/9;align-items:center;display:flex;justify-content:center;font-size:calc(var(--containerSize) * var(--leaderFrac) / var(--textLen) * 16 / 9 * 0.8);cursor:default;user-select:none;font-family:'Courier New', Courier, monospace}.popup.svelte-1fhamia{background-color:#00000030;border-radius:0.5em;padding-left:0.5em;padding-right:0.5em;border:1px solid #00000030}.hidden.svelte-1fhamia{display:none}.btn-small.svelte-1fhamia{padding-top:0;padding-bottom:0}.draggable.svelte-1fhamia{position:absolute;z-index:9;background-color:#f1f1f1;border:1px solid #d3d3d3;text-align:center}.draghdr.svelte-1fhamia{padding-right:3em;padding-left:3em;cursor:grab}#map.svelte-1fhamia{border:2px solid;padding-bottom:20px;width:300px;height:300px;resize:both;overflow:auto}.ph.svelte-ocpy68{position:absolute;font-size:calc(450px/5);aspect-ratio:1280/720;height:300px;align-items:center;display:flex;justify-content:center;font-family:monospace}.cam-audio-grid-icon.svelte-129qho9 .svelte-129qho9,.pad-2px.svelte-129qho9.svelte-129qho9{padding-left:2px;padding-right:2px}.cam-audio-grid.svelte-129qho9.svelte-129qho9{display:flex;align-items:center}.cam-audio-label.svelte-129qho9.svelte-129qho9{font-size:20px;margin-bottom:-2px;vertical-align:bottom}.transparent-btn.svelte-129qho9.svelte-129qho9{color:white;background-color:rgba(0, 0, 0, 0.5)}.transparent-btn.svelte-129qho9.svelte-129qho9:hover{color:#bdc3c7}.top-left-abs.svelte-129qho9.svelte-129qho9{left:0;top:0;position:absolute}.hidden.svelte-129qho9.svelte-129qho9{display:none}.full-width.svelte-129qho9.svelte-129qho9{width:100%}.overlay.svelte-129qho9.svelte-129qho9{background-color:#0000005c;right:0;bottom:0;position:absolute;padding:10px;border-radius:5px 0px 0px 0px;border:solid 1px #00000075;text-align:left;font-size:14px;z-index:2}.rec-container.svelte-129qho9.svelte-129qho9{line-height:1;padding:10px;position:absolute;right:0;top:0}.rec-button.svelte-129qho9.svelte-129qho9{width:14px;height:14px;font-size:0;background-color:#f00;border:0;border-radius:20px;outline:none;vertical-align:middle;display:inline-block}.rec.svelte-129qho9.svelte-129qho9{animation:svelte-129qho9-blinker 1s step-end infinite}.not-rec.svelte-129qho9.svelte-129qho9{background-color:#bdc3c7}.rec-button.svelte-129qho9.svelte-129qho9:disabled{background-color:#ecf0f1}@keyframes svelte-129qho9-blinker{50%{opacity:0}}.button.svelte-129qho9.svelte-129qho9{display:inline-block;font-weight:400;text-align:center;white-space:nowrap;vertical-align:middle;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;border:1px solid transparent;padding:0.3rem 0.5rem;border-radius:0.26rem;transition:color .15s ease-in-out,background-color .15s ease-in-out,border-color .15s ease-in-out,box-shadow .15s ease-in-out;z-index:2}.btn-danger.svelte-129qho9.svelte-129qho9{color:#fff;background-color:#c0392b;border-color:#c0392b}hr.svelte-129qho9.svelte-129qho9{margin:4px 0px 4px 0px;display:block;border:none;height:2px}.take-photo.svelte-129qho9.svelte-129qho9:disabled{background-color:#27ae60;color:#ecf0f1}.float-right.svelte-129qho9.svelte-129qho9{float:right}input[type=range].svelte-129qho9.svelte-129qho9{width:100%}.opt-row.svelte-129qho9.svelte-129qho9{padding-top:4px;padding-bottom:4px}.record-grid.svelte-129qho9.svelte-129qho9{display:grid;grid-template-columns:1fr auto}.record-grid.svelte-129qho9 .svelte-129qho9{margin-left:2px;margin-right:2px}.switch-button.svelte-129qho9.svelte-129qho9{box-sizing:border-box;background:rgba(16, 16, 16, 0.56);border-radius:10px;overflow:hidden;width:150px;text-align:center;position:relative;padding-right:15px;padding-left:0;position:relative;height:20px;margin-bottom:-2px}.switch-button.svelte-129qho9.svelte-129qho9:before{content:var(--label);position:absolute;top:0;bottom:0;right:0;width:75px;display:flex;align-items:center;justify-content:center;z-index:3;pointer-events:none}.switch-button-checkbox.svelte-129qho9.svelte-129qho9{cursor:pointer;position:absolute;top:0;left:0;bottom:0;width:100%;height:20px;opacity:0;z-index:2}.switch-button-checkbox.svelte-129qho9:checked+.switch-button-label.svelte-129qho9:before{transform:translateX(75px) ;transition:transform 300ms linear}.switch-button-checkbox.svelte-129qho9+.switch-button-label.svelte-129qho9{position:relative;padding:0;display:block;user-select:none;pointer-events:none;width:75px;height:20px;display:flex;align-items:center;justify-content:center}.switch-button-checkbox.svelte-129qho9+.switch-button-label.svelte-129qho9:before{content:"";background:#0066ffdd;border:1px solid #aaa;height:20px;width:100%;position:absolute;left:0;top:0;border-radius:10px;transform:translateX(0) ;transition:transform 300ms}.switch-button-checkbox+.switch-button-label.svelte-129qho9 .switch-button-label-span.svelte-129qho9{position:relative}label.svelte-qozwl4.svelte-qozwl4{position:absolute;width:1px;height:1px;margin:-1px;padding:0;overflow:hidden;white-space:nowrap;border:0;visibility:inherit;clip:rect(0, 0, 0, 0)}[role="search"].svelte-qozwl4.svelte-qozwl4{position:relative;display:flex;max-width:28rem;width:100%;margin-left:0.5rem;height:3rem;background-color:#393939;color:#fff;transition:max-width 0.11s cubic-bezier(0.2, 0, 0.38, 0.9),
      background 0.11s cubic-bezier(0.2, 0, 0.38, 0.9)}[role="search"].svelte-qozwl4.svelte-qozwl4:not(.active){max-width:3rem;background-color:#161616}[role="search"].active.svelte-qozwl4.svelte-qozwl4{outline:2px solid #fff;outline-offset:-2px}[role="combobox"].svelte-qozwl4.svelte-qozwl4{display:flex;flex-grow:1;border-bottom:1px solid #393939}input.svelte-qozwl4.svelte-qozwl4{width:100%;height:3rem;padding:0;font-size:1rem;font-weight:400;line-height:1.375rem;letter-spacing:0;color:#fff;caret-color:#fff;background-color:initial;border:none;outline:none;transition:opacity 0.11s cubic-bezier(0.2, 0, 0.38, 0.9)}input.svelte-qozwl4.svelte-qozwl4:not(.active){opacity:0;pointer-events:none}button.svelte-qozwl4.svelte-qozwl4{width:3rem;height:100%;padding:0;flex-shrink:0;opacity:1;transition:background-color 0.11s cubic-bezier(0.2, 0, 0.38, 0.9),
      opacity 0.11s cubic-bezier(0.2, 0, 0.38, 0.9)}.disabled.svelte-qozwl4.svelte-qozwl4{border:none;pointer-events:none}[aria-label="Clear search"].svelte-qozwl4.svelte-qozwl4:hover{background-color:#4c4c4c}.hidden.svelte-qozwl4.svelte-qozwl4{opacity:0;display:none}ul.svelte-qozwl4.svelte-qozwl4{position:absolute;z-index:10000;padding:1rem 0;left:0;right:0;top:3rem;background-color:#161616;border:1px solid #393939;border-top:none;box-shadow:0 4px 8px 0 rgba(0, 0, 0, 0.5)}[role="menuitem"].svelte-qozwl4.svelte-qozwl4{padding:6px 1rem;cursor:pointer;font-size:0.875rem;font-weight:600;line-height:1.29;letter-spacing:0.16px;transition:all 70ms cubic-bezier(0.2, 0, 0.38, 0.9);display:block;text-decoration:none;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;color:#c6c6c6}.selected.svelte-qozwl4.svelte-qozwl4,[role="menuitem"].svelte-qozwl4.svelte-qozwl4:hover{background-color:#353535;color:#f4f4f4}[role="menuitem"].svelte-qozwl4 span.svelte-qozwl4{font-size:0.75rem;font-weight:400;line-height:1.34;letter-spacing:0.32px;text-transform:lowercase;color:#c6c6c6}.action-link.svelte-1viyq4q{text-align:center;align-items:center;vertical-align:middle;justify-content:center;padding-top:10px}.action-text.svelte-19vx6se.svelte-19vx6se{font-size:16px;line-height:20px;text-decoration:none;color:#fff;width:100%;padding:0 1rem}.action-text.svelte-19vx6se>span.svelte-19vx6se{margin-left:0.75rem;vertical-align:top}.search-wrapper.svelte-16k0yud{position:relative;display:flex;max-width:28rem;width:100%;margin-left:0.5rem;height:3rem;background-color:#393939;color:#fff;transition:max-width 0.11s cubic-bezier(0.2, 0, 0.38, 0.9),
      background 0.11s cubic-bezier(0.2, 0, 0.38, 0.9)}.search-wrapper-hidden.svelte-16k0yud{max-width:3rem;background-color:#161616}.search-focus.svelte-16k0yud{outline:2px solid #fff;outline-offset:-2px}.search-wrapper-2.svelte-16k0yud{display:flex;flex-grow:1;border-bottom:1px solid #393939}.btn-search.svelte-16k0yud{width:3rem;height:100%;padding:0;flex-shrink:0;opacity:1;transition:background-color 0.11s cubic-bezier(0.2, 0, 0.38, 0.9),
      opacity 0.11s cubic-bezier(0.2, 0, 0.38, 0.9)}.btn-search-disabled.svelte-16k0yud{border:none;pointer-events:none}.input-search.svelte-16k0yud{font-size:1rem;font-weight:400;line-height:1.375rem;letter-spacing:0;color:#fff;caret-color:#fff;background-color:initial;border:none;outline:none;width:100%;height:3rem;padding:0;transition:opacity 0.11s cubic-bezier(0.2, 0, 0.38, 0.9)}.input-hidden.svelte-16k0yud{opacity:0;pointer-events:none}.btn-clear.svelte-16k0yud{width:3rem;height:100%;padding:0;flex-shrink:0;opacity:1;display:block;transition:background-color 0.11s cubic-bezier(0.2, 0, 0.38, 0.9),
      opacity 0.11s cubic-bezier(0.2, 0, 0.38, 0.9)}.btn-clear.svelte-16k0yud:hover{background-color:#4c4c4c}.btn-clear-hidden.svelte-16k0yud{opacity:0;display:none}.subject-divider.svelte-298l2.svelte-298l2{color:#525252;padding-bottom:4px;border-bottom:1px solid #525252;margin:32px 1rem 8px}.subject-divider.svelte-298l2 span.svelte-298l2{font-size:0.75rem;font-weight:400;line-height:1rem;letter-spacing:0.32px;color:#c6c6c6}input[type=range].svelte-7cjc19{width:100%}